What Are Turtles?
“Turtles” are a classic candy made of pecans, caramel, and chocolate, arranged in a way that resembles a turtle’s shell and legs. Traditionally, they require careful stovetop work, but this crockpot version lets the slow cooker do the heavy lifting. The result is a batch of candies perfect for holiday gifts, potlucks, or just a sweet snack at home.
Ingredients You’ll Need
To make Easy Crockpot Turtles, you only need a handful of pantry staples:
- 2 cups pecan halves – roasted for extra flavor.
- 1 (12 oz) bag semi-sweet chocolate chips.
- 1 (12 oz) bag milk chocolate chips.
- 1 (10 oz) bag caramel bits (or unwrapped soft caramels).
- 1 tablespoon heavy cream (optional, for smoother caramel).
- Sea salt flakes (optional, for garnish).
Step-by-Step Method
Step 1: Prepare Your Slow Cooker
Spray the inside of your slow cooker with a light coating of non-stick spray or line it with parchment paper. This will make cleanup easier and prevent sticking.
Step 2: Layer the Ingredients
- Place the pecan halves evenly at the bottom of the crockpot.
- Sprinkle in the caramel bits (or soft caramel pieces). If using soft caramels, stir them with a tablespoon of heavy cream to help them melt smoothly.
- Add both the semi-sweet and milk chocolate chips on top.
Do not stir yet—allow the heat to slowly melt the ingredients together.
